Hospital Newborn Nursery
Every baby in the nation is touched by the March of Dimes in the first days life. Hospitals provide an APGAR Score for every newborn, a clinical system of evaluating the physical condition of a newborn. Used by obstetical practices around the world, it was developed by Virginia Apgar, MD who worked for March of Dimes from 1959 until her death in 1976.
Grocery Store
Enriched breads, grains, pasta and cereals. Walk down the aisles of your local grocery store and the March of Dimes is there. Take a close look at the labels on breads, grains, pastas and cereals and you will see that they are fortified with folic acid. The March of Dimes advocated for folic acid fortification of grain products which led to a 30% reduction in neural tube defects–deadly and crippling defects of the brain and spinal column.
Pediatricians Offices
Polio vaccine. The March of Dimes provided complete funding for the development of the Salk polio vaccine and the successful field trial that proved the safety and effectiveness of the vaccine. The March of Dimes also funded research that led to the development of the Sabin polio vaccine. Pediatricians still vaccinate newborns for polio which is eradicated in this nation.

Professional Education
March of Dimes provides continuing education to doctors, nurses and health care professionals on issues that affect our mission such as genetics, prematurity, prenatal care, preconception health, cultural competency, care of the high risk newborn, diabetes and pregnancy, alcohol, tobacco and other drug use, sexually transmitted infections, etc.
